what is the slant height of the cone if it has a height of 9 ft and a radius of 8 ft

To find the slant height of the cone, we can use the Pythagorean theorem.

The slant height (l) can be found using the formula:
l = √(r^2 + h^2)

Given that the radius (r) is 8 ft and the height (h) is 9 ft, we can plug these values into the formula:

l = √(8^2 + 9^2)
l = √(64 + 81)
l = √145
l ≈ 12.04 ft

Therefore, the slant height of the cone is approximately 12.04 ft.
